The most common failure is uppercase keywords mixed with lowercase identifiers, which Sifter flags as style violation S-12. Fix these locally by running the sifter-fmt script before pushing. Do not disable rules inline; the Dalewick platform team reviews every suppression. If the lint stage still fails after formatting, grab the token printed at the end of the job log and paste it into your ticket. The token appears below.

session token of tajef-bageg = htk21_5d90d574934f3ccae6437

Subject: Access arrangements — shared lab, Level 2 East

Hello Facilities team,

As discussed, the Pellworth instrumentation lab on Level 2 East is now shared with the Varnholm analytics group. Please ensure the booking sheet on the lab door is checked before granting entry, and remind occupants that the fume cabinet side door must remain closed outside supervised hours. Cleaning crews should only enter between 06:00 and 07:30. The lab's main entrance keypad has been reprogrammed; use the code below.

door code, yagap-bahof: bdg-O-05

## Local Setup: Bulk Edits

The Quillbench admin table supports bulk edits via the `bulkops` service. Run `make seed-admin` first so the table has rows to work with, then start the service with `npm run bulkops:dev`. Edits are staged in a local queue and flushed every ten seconds. The service reads its connection settings from your environment, using the value below.

primary connection of kahof-kagep = mssql://belath_svc:3uqY4g6LHG5Nyi@db-d0ba.ferralabs.corp:5432/rusdor